2011 is here and if it is time to start thinking about getting your child a cell phone, or upgrading the phone they already have, I have put together a list of the different options you have.

Firefly glow Phone- This is another phone designed for preteens and children you think are too young to have a lot of features. The glow Phone does have voice mail but not a lot of other features. There are two big programmable keys meant for calling Mom and Dad but you can program any number into them. Parents can also set the glow Phone up where only certain numbers can be called out and received.

Buddy Bear Phone is a simplified GSM handset aimed at children in the 3-10 years old range. The Buddy Bear can only dial four pre-programmed numbers, or send a pre-programmed SMS message to four different recipients. There is a SOS button on either side of the bear's head. For added cuteness, LEDs flash in the bear's ears when it receives a call. There's no screen on the Buddy Bear which reduces cost and is one less thing to break. The Buddy Bear can be remotely controlled by parents who can block the phone with a PIN number if ...
... it is lost or stolen. It can also be turned into a remote baby monitor, so parents can listen to what is going on in their handset's vicinity without their child knowing. Parents can also remotely control the Buddy Bear's settings and will get an SMS if the handset gets a low battery. The phone is either remotely programmed from another mobile handset or via the USB cable. Buddy Bear's distributors also say that the handset has a very low SAR rating and is paint-free for added safety.

Advantages of Cell Phones for Kids
According to a May 16, 2009 article posted on About.com, “Kids and Cell Phones” by Vincent Inanely, M.D., a distinct advantage for parents allowing their children to have cell phones is that they can keep in touch with them, not only for day-to-day practical purposes, but for emergency situations as well. Parents who opt to get their children cell phones with a GPS have the added advantage of keeping track of where the children are at all times. This is particularly beneficial for parents of driving teens.
